We have found the following list of companies/organizations inside the directory of Energy
There are 16 companies in the Hydropower .
5th floor, Alliance Tower Charkhal Road, Dillibazar, Kathmandu
Blue Energy Ltd. (BEL) registered in Nepal in 2007, is a fully owned subsidiary of Saraf Group. BEL has embarked upon hydropower business in Nepal and currently developing three ...